Kakao Entertainment said on the 9th that Melon, the music platform it operates, will host the 2026 Melon Music Awards (MMA2026) at Gocheok Sky Dome in Seoul from Nov. 14 to 15. This is the first year MMA will be held on two consecutive days.

This year's MMA theme is "connect," and the slogan is "K-POP CONNECT: The New Pulse." A Melon official said, "It defines the moment when fans around the world come together through K-pop and become one beyond time and space, and MMA2026 carries the meaning of becoming the starting point of a new musical movement (Pulse) for artists and the global fandom."

Melon has recently focused on creating new standards to capture global K-pop trends, such as unveiling the "Global-K Chart" with China's Tencent Music and Japan's Line Music. Melon plans to link the "Global-K Chart" with MMA202 to reflect the opinions of K-pop fans around the world, beyond Korea, in the award results.

A Melon official said, "MMA is the biggest K-pop festival, completed by 22 years of data accumulated by Melon and the heartfelt participation of fans," adding, "This year, with the first two-day event and the linkage with the 'Global-K Chart,' we will take a further step forward as an awards ceremony created together by K-pop fans around the world, beyond Korea."
